Tricyclic cytosine (tC) is a fluorescent analog of cytosine designed for RNA imaging within live cells, facilitating the study of RNA synthesis, degradation, and trafficking with single-cell precision through confocal imaging. This compound features excitation/emission maxima (λ) of 375/505 nm, an extinction coefficient of 4000 M^-1cm^-1, and a quantum yield of 0.2.

Molecular Weight | 349.36 |
Formula | C15H15N3O5S |
Cas No. | 1174063-74-1 |
Storage | keep away from direct sunlight |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ice. |
